Rush Lake Hills
Rush Lake Hills, located in Pinckney, Michigan, is a classic golf course designed by Robert Herndon back in 1959. It's a full 18-hole course with a par of 73, offering a refreshing blend of Bent Grass greens and Bluegrass fairways. The course is reasonably priced at just $21, whether you're swinging by for a weekend round or a weekday game. It operates from 7:00 AM to 5:00 PM, with the earliest tee time available at 7:00 AM. Keep in mind that the greens are typically aerated in May and August and the course features up to 10 bunkers to challenge your game. However, do note that Rush Lake Hills does not accommodate fivesome golf groups.

Whispering Pines
Whispering Pines in Pinckney, Michigan, is a classic golf course designed by Don Moon in 1991. The course, beautifully carpeted with Bent Grass on both the greens and fairways, offers 18 holes of play for a reasonable fee of $45, whether you choose to tee off on a weekday or weekend starting as early as 6:00 AM. It's worth noting that the greens are typically aerated in September, which may slightly affect your play. The course features 20 strategically placed bunkers, adding a challenging element to your game. However, please be aware that fivesome golf groups are not permitted. With hours extending till 5:00 PM, Whispering Pines provides ample time for a satisfying round of golf.

Timber Trace Golf Club
Timber Trace Golf Club in Pinckney, Michigan, designed by Conroy-Dewling Associates, Inc. in 1998, is a beautiful 18-hole course that offers a challenging par of 72. The course, open from 7:30 AM to 5:00 PM, has a well-maintained Bent Grass green and fairway, providing a high-quality playing surface. With over 80 strategically placed bunkers, golfers are sure to enjoy a challenging yet enjoyable round. The earliest tee time is 7:30 AM, perfect for those who enjoy a morning game. Priced at $45 for both weekdays and weekends, Timber Trace offers a consistent and affordable golfing experience. However, please note that groups of five are not permitted on this course.
